The `cutlist.addCut()` store method will add a set of cutting instructions for the part.
This information is not use by the core library, it is merely stored.
## Signature
`cutlist.addCut()` accepts either an object or an array of objects
with the following signature:
```js
undefined store.cutlist.addCut({
Number cut,
String from,
Bool identical = false,
Bool onBias = false,
Bool onFold = false,
})
```
Pass an object or an array of objects to the `cutlist.addCut()`
method with any of the following keys;
any you don't provide will be filled with the defaults:
| Key | Type | Default | Description |
| :-- | :--- | :------ | :---------- |
| `cut` | Number\|false | 2 | The number of parts to cut from the specified material. Pass `false` to clear cutting instructions for the material |
| `from` | String | 'fabric' | The (translation key of the) material to cut from |
| `identical` | Boolean | false | Should even numbers of parts be cut in the same direction? The default (`false`) is to mirror them |
| `onBias` | Boolean | false | Should the parts be cut on the bias? |
| `onFold` | Boolean | false | Should the parts be cut on the fold? |
:::note
You can use any `string` you want for your material, but here are some standard ones we provide translations for:
| Key | Translation |
|:--|:--|
| fabric | Main Fabric |
| lining | Lining |
| canvas | Canvas |
| interfacing | Interfacing |
| ribbing | Ribbing |
:::
## Example
<Example caption="An example of the cutlist.addCut() store method">
```js
({ Point, Path, paths, macro, store, part }) => {
store.cutlist.addCut({cut: 2, from: 'fabric' })
store.cutlist.addCut({cut: 2, from: 'lining' })
macro('title', {
nr: 9,
title: 'The title',
at: new Point(0,0),
scale: 0.5,
})
// Prevent clipping
paths.diag = new Path()
.move(new Point(-10,-20))
.move(new Point(80,35))
return part
}
```
